Features & Benefits of Music Nomad's Diamond Coated Nut Files to Cut & Polish your Nut or Saddle

Description
WARNING: These files cut really well! MusicNomad’s Nut Files feature a revolutionary diamond coating and round “string-shape” blade design resulting in smooth, precision cuts. They cut and polish slots at the same time and do not drift like common toothed files. The industrial, even diamond coating cuts all common nut or saddle materials, such as nylon, bone, graphite and TUSQ. MusicNomad added an ergonomic handle for total comfort and control of your cut, or you can remove the blade from the handle as an alternative cutting option. This custom set comes with 6 nut file sizes for electric guitar with super light strings. It includes a compact, aluminum case.



Features
- Innovative Round "String-Shape" blade design that won't bend
- Laser-engraved size on each blade
- Ergonomic handle and convenient workbench hang hole
- Perfect for cutting and polishing at the same time
- Great for all the most common nut materials such as nylon, bone, graphite and TUSQ
- Also works amazingly on saddles
